Outlook 10/23: U.S. stock futures fall Monday as Treasury yields rose and traders looked ahead to the release of corporate earnings from tech industry giants. The benchmark 10-year Treasury note yield briefly climbed back above the key 5% level. It was last trading just below that mark. Interest rates have soared in recent weeks, with the 10-year’s break above 5% on Thursday marking the first such occurrence for the benchmark since July of 2007. Comments from Federal Reserve chair Jerome Powell that monetary policy could tighten further seemingly stoked investor concern and underpinned the rise in Treasury yields.
